2-Hexanol

Pharmaceutical Materials 2025-03-03

CAS Number: 626-93-7

Molecular Formula: C6H14O

Molecular Weight: 102.175

Appearance: Clear colorless liquid

Melting Point: -23°C

Boiling Point: 139°C

Density: 0.81 g/cm³

Usage: Used as a solvent, emulsifier, and in the production of adipic acid, plasticizers, and detergents.

 

Property Details
Chemical Formula C₆H₁₄O
IUPAC Name Hexan-2-ol
Other Names sec-Hexyl alcohol, 2-Hydroxyhexane, Methyl pentyl carbinol
CAS Number 626-93-7
Appearance Colorless liquid
Odor Mild, characteristic alcohol odor
Molecular Weight 102.17 g/mol
Solubility Slightly soluble in water; miscible with ethanol, ether
Melting Point -23°C
Boiling Point 139°C
Density 0.81 g/cm³ (at 20°C)
Flash Point 41°C (closed cup)
Applications Solvent, emulsifier, precursor for adipic acid, plasticizers, detergents
Preparation Grignard reaction (bromobutane + Mg → add acetone → acid hydrolysis)
Safety Flammable; irritating to eyes, skin, and respiratory tract
Storage Keep in cool, ventilated area; away from heat, sparks, and oxidizers
